For example, consider the following problem: Express 605 as the sum of two squares NettetCube of a Number. The cube of a number is the multiplication by itself thrice. That means, for any integer, we can obtain the cube by multiplying the integer by its square. For example, the cube of an integer 5 will be: 5 2 × 5 or 5 × 5 × 5, i.e., the cube of 5 is equal to 125. NettetIn math, the squared symbol ( 2) is an arithmetic operator that signifies multiplying a number by itself. The “square” of a number is the product of the number and itself. Multiplying a number by itself is called “squaring” the number. NettetIn general, x * x is either much faster than or about the same as a pow () call in any language. pow () is a general exponential designed to work with floating point arguments, and it usually uses a calculation that has a lot more operations than a single multiplication. It's notoriously slow.

In mathematics, a square number or perfect square is an integer that is the square of an integer; in other words, it is the product of some integer with itself. For example, 9 is a square number, since it equals 3 and can be written as 3 × 3.
